Introducing the Kartal District: The Eagle-Eyed Vision of Istanbul

Kartal, which means "Eagle" in Turkish, is a fitting name for a district that targets a bright future with its broad vision. This area, once a quiet fishing village, has now transformed into one of the most important judicial, commercial, and residential centers on the Asian side.

  • Location: Situated on the coast of the Marmara Sea, neighboring important districts like Maltepe, Pendik, and Sancaktepe.

  • Population: Over 480,000 residents.

  • Neighborhoods: Comprises 20 diverse neighborhoods, each with its unique character.

2. A Strategic Transportation Hub

Thanks to its powerful transportation infrastructure, Kartal is a major communication artery on the Asian side:

  • Highways: Direct and fast access to Istanbul's two main arteries, the E-5 (D-100) and TEM highways.

  • Metro: The M4 Metro Line (Kadıköy - Sabiha Gökçen Airport) passes through, connecting to the Marmaray line, which links the Asian side to the heart of Europe in minutes.

  • Sea Transport: The presence of sea bus (IDO) piers and a ferry port makes travel to various points easy and enjoyable.

  • Proximity to Airport: The distance to Sabiha Gökçen International Airport (SAW) is only 15 to 20 minutes.

Market Analysis and Property Prices in Kartal (2025 Update)

The Kartal real estate market, with its wide variety from one-bedroom apartments to 5.5-bedroom duplex units, caters to every budget and taste.

  • Average Price: In mid-2025, the average price per square meter for new apartments in Kartal is approximately 60,000 Turkish Lira.

  • Neighborhood Comparison:

    • Most Expensive Neighborhoods: Areas like Kordonboyu and Orhantepe have the highest prices due to their proximity to the coastline and luxury projects.

    • Affordable Neighborhoods: Districts such as Uğur Mumcu and Hürriyet offer more budget-friendly options with good growth potential.

  • Landmark Projects: Projects like İstMarina, with its full range of amenities and direct access to a shopping mall, are examples of the luxury lifestyle in Kartal.

Legal Steps and Key Tips for a Secure Purchase

  1. Title Deed (Tapu) Inquiry: Be sure to verify, through a reputable expert, that the property's title deed is free of any debts, mortgages, or legal issues.

  2. Occupancy Permit (İskan Belgesi): The existence of this permit proves that the building was constructed in accordance with municipal standards and is ready for occupancy.

  3. Compulsory Earthquake Insurance (DASK): This insurance is mandatory in Turkey and must be obtained before the title deed transfer.

  4. Additional Costs: Factor in expenses such as the title deed transfer tax (4%), notary fees, and real estate agent commission in your budget.
